Subject: [PATCH 09/10] htl: Add C11 threads types definitions

sysdeps/htl/bits/thread-shared-types.h | 13 +++++++++++++
1 file changed, 13 insertions(+)
diff --git a/sysdeps/htl/bits/thread-shared-types.h b/sysdeps/htl/bits/thread-shared-types.h
index c280f2e182..819682a07b 100644
--- a/sysdeps/htl/bits/thread-shared-types.h
+++ b/sysdeps/htl/bits/thread-shared-types.h
@@ -20,5 +20,18 @@
#define _THREAD_SHARED_TYPES_H 1
#include <bits/pthreadtypes-arch.h>
+#include <bits/types/struct___pthread_once.h>
+
+typedef int __tss_t;
+typedef int __thrd_t;
+
+typedef union
+{
+ struct __pthread_once __data;
+ int __align __ONCE_ALIGNMENT;
+ char __size[__SIZEOF_PTHREAD_ONCE_T];
+} __once_flag;
+
+#define __ONCE_FLAG_INIT { { __PTHREAD_ONCE_INIT } }
#endif /* _THREAD_SHARED_TYPES_H */
